What is the digital signature legitimacy for manufacturing in Mexico

The digital signature legitimacy for manufacturing in Mexico refers to the legal recognition and validation of electronic signatures within the manufacturing sector. This legitimacy ensures that digital signatures hold the same we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ided they meet specific legal criteria set forth by Mexican law. This framework is crucial for manufacturers who engage in contracts, agreements, and compliance documentation, as it streamlines processes and enhances efficiency.

Legal use of the digital signature legitimacy for manufacturing in Mexico

The legal use of digital signatures in the manufacturing sector in Mexico is governed by specific laws, including the Federal Civil Code and the Electronic Signature Law. These regulations establish the criteria for what constitutes a valid digital signature, ensuring that it can be used in legal agreements and contracts. Manufacturers must adhere to these laws to ensure that their electronic signatures are enforceable and recognized in legal proceedings.

Examples of using the digital signature legitimacy for manufacturing in Mexico

Digital signatures can be applied in various scenarios within the manufacturing sector, such as:

  • Signing contracts with suppliers and vendors.
  • Approving purchase orders and invoices.
  • Finalizing compliance documents and safety certifications.
  • Facilitating employee onboarding and HR documentation.

These examples illustrate how digital signatures enhance efficiency and streamline processes in manufacturing operations.
